What is a meta description?
A meta description is an HTML attribute that provides a brief summary of a web page. Search engines like Google often display this description in search results below the page title.
What is the optimal meta description length?
For desktop search, the optimal meta description length is 150 to 160 characters. For mobile search, Google truncates descriptions after roughly 120 characters. It is best to front-load important keywords.
Does Google use meta descriptions for ranking?
Google does not use meta descriptions as a direct search ranking factor. However, a well-written meta description directly increases click-through rate (CTR), which drives organic traffic and signals high relevance.
Why does Google show a different meta description than what I wrote?
Google will dynamically generate a snippet from the page content if it believes the user's search query matches page text better than your written meta description, or if your meta description is low quality or stuffed with keywords.
